Job Description

Explore Where Accounting, Technology, and Risk Management Meet

Are you a rising junior who enjoys solving problems, asking questions, and finding better ways to work? If you're exploring how an accounting degree can be applied beyond traditional public accounting paths, this internship offers a unique opportunity to see how technology, risk management, compliance, and business operations come together within a Fortune 15 healthcare company.

As an IT Audit (SOX/SOC) Intern, you'll gain hands-on exposure to enterprise systems, internal controls, and auditing practices that help protect and strengthen our business. You'll work alongside experienced professionals, participate in real audit activities, and build an understanding of how technology risks are managed across a complex organization. Most importantly, you'll be encouraged to learn, explore, and discover the career path that's right for you.

Responsibilities

  • Participate in IT control walkthroughs and audit discussions to gain insight into how organizations assess and manage technology risk.

  • Support projects related to Sarbanes-Oxley (SOX) and System and Organization Controls (SOC) compliance by helping gather, analyze, and organize information.

  • Observe and collaborate with internal audit, compliance, and technology professionals to understand how controls support business objectives.

  • Contribute to process improvement and automation initiatives designed to increase efficiency and strengthen control environments.

  • Analyze information, identify trends, and help teams evaluate opportunities to enhance processes and reduce risk.

  • Attend team meetings, stakeholder discussions, and cross-functional calls to expand your knowledge, build your network, and gain exposure to a variety of career paths.

  • Learn how technology, accounting, compliance, and business operations intersect within a large, highly regulated enterprise environment.

Required Qualifications

  • Rising junior pursuing a bachelor's degree in accounting.

  • Strong analytical and problem-solving skills.

  • Curiosity and willingness to ask questions, seek feedback, and learn from new experiences.

  • Ability to navigate ambiguity and adapt to evolving priorities.

  • Strong written and verbal communication skills.

  • Ability to collaborate effectively in a team environment.

  • Familiarity with AI tools or technologies through academic, professional, or personal projects is preferred, along with an understanding of responsible and ethical use of AI.

Preferred Qualifications

  • Interest in auditing, risk management, compliance, cybersecurity, technology controls, or process improvement.

  • Experience using data analysis, reporting, or business technology tools through coursework, student organizations, internships, or projects.

  • Demonstrated initiative through leadership experiences, work experience, campus involvement, or independent learning.

Additional Information

Location: Interns are expected to work a hybrid schedule, spending three days per week in our Franklin, TN office and two days working remotely.

Compensation: Hourly pay ranges from $23.00-$25.00, based on degree program, and year of study.

Work Authorization: Candidates must be authorized to work in the United States and not require current or future employment sponsorship.

Enterprise Intern Schedule: This is a full-time summer internship (40 hours per week) running from May 24 through July 30th, 2027.

If you will be working at home occasionally or permanently, the internet connection must be obtained through a cable broadband or fiber optic internet service provider with speeds of at least 10Mbps download/5Mbps upload.
